The Production and Properties of 180 Ksi Minimum-Yield-Strength Maraging Steels

摘要

This report describeds the production and properties of hemispheres produced from 5/8-inch-thick plate, of 1/4-, 1/2-, 1-1/4-, 1-1/2-, 1-3/4-, 2-, 3-, and 4-1/2-inch-thick plates, and of 1/16-inch-diameter welding electrodes pro duced under this contract. Plates for 5/8-inch-thick hemispheres were from a part of an 80-ton electricfurnace heat of 18Ni-8Co-2.6Mo steel. Because plates 1 inch thick and over from this heat did not meet the Charpy impact-test specifications, all plates other than the 5/8inch-thick plate were produced from 20-ton electricfurnace heats of 12Ni-5Cr-3Mo steel. Welding electrodes of both the 18Ni-8Co-2.6Mo and 12Ni-5Cr-3Mo steel compositions were produced from 300-pound vacuuminduction furnace heats. The results of tension and impact tests showed that all materials met the mechanical-property specifications. In addition, the results of supplementary studies on aging response, stress-strain characteristics in tension and compression, moduli of elasticity, coefficients of thermal expansion, transformation temperatures, and grain size and microstructure of the two steels are reported.
